Hi,
I am having trouble getting a simple event listener class to work. The class is:
package {
import flash.display.Sprite;
import flash.events.*;
public class KeyEvent extends Sprite {
private var eventSprite:Sprite;
public function KeyEvent() {
setUp();
}
private function setUp(){
trace("In setUp");
eventSprite = new Sprite();
addChild(eventSprite);
eventSprite.addEventListener(KeyboardEvent.KEY_DOWN, keyList);
}
private function keyList(){
trace("In keyList");
}
}
}
and I am adding it to the first frame of my flash file like this:
import KeyEvent;
var test:KeyEvent = new KeyEvent();
and I have the ClassPath pointing to the folder that contains this .as file.
I do get the trace “In setUp” but I’m not getting seeing any Keyboard events. There also aren’t any errors showing up in output so I am kind of stumped.
Thanks for any help!
Phed